Different Welder’s Qualifications

Although the American Welding Society’s basic CW card opens the door for most employment opportunities, many fields call for their certain certificate. Several of the most-well-known of these are listed below.

  • ASME Certification for those who handle boiler and pressurized containers
  • Certified Welder Certification to become a Certified Welder
  • API Certification for those who work with pipelines in the oil and gas industry
  • CWI and SCWI Certification for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ors

The below data features wage and jobs projections for professional welders in New Hampshire through 2022.

New Hampshire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 970 1,020 5% 30
New Hampshire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$27,400 $41,200 $57,300

Source: O*Net Online

Welding Specialist Courses – The Things You Can Expect

Choosing which program to go to can be an individual decision, however there are some items you should know before choosing certified welding schools. You could possibly hear that brazing training are all similar, but there are some issues you need to look into before selecting which brazing programs to enroll in in Brookfield, NH. Certainly, the key element of any school is that it needs to have the proper certification from the American Welding Society. Right after checking out the accreditation situation, you may have to look just a little deeper to be sure that the program you are considering can offer you the most-effective training.

  • Make certain the college’s program features classes in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
  • Watch for institutions that meet AWS SENSE standards
  • Find out if the program supplies financial support
  • Make certain the school trains on tools that matches the latest field requirements
